Our immune system is the body's natural defense mechanism against bacteria, viruses, fungi, and other harmful microorganisms. When immunity becomes weak, the body struggles to fight infections, making a person more likely to experience frequent colds, coughs, fever, sinus infections, throat infections, skin infections, slow wound healing, and prolonged recovery from illness. Low immunity can affect both children and adults and may significantly reduce quality of life. Proper medical evaluation is important to identify the underlying cause.

What is Low Immunity?

Low immunity means the body's immune system is less effective at protecting against infections. A weakened immune system may lead to repeated infections, slower recovery, and increased susceptibility to illness. Low immunity can result from nutritional deficiencies, chronic diseases, certain medications, stress, inadequate sleep, or inherited immune disorders.

Diagnosis

Your doctor may recommend:

  • Complete Blood Count (CBC)

  • Vitamin D test

  • Vitamin B12

  • Iron studies

  • Blood sugar

  • Thyroid profile

  • Zinc levels (when appropriate)

  • Immunoglobulin tests (if immune deficiency is suspected)

  • Additional investigations based on symptoms

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)


1. What causes low immunity?


Low immunity can result from poor nutrition, stress, chronic illnesses, certain medicines, inadequate sleep, or inherited immune disorders.


2. Can children develop low immunity?


Yes. Children may experience frequent infections, but persistent or unusually severe infections should be assessed by a doctor.


3. Can adults have low immunity?


Yes. Adults with chronic diseases, nutritional deficiencies, or certain medications may have weakened immunity.


4. Can stress weaken immunity?


Long-term stress may negatively affect immune function.


5. Which foods improve immunity?


Fruits, vegetables, lean protein, nuts, seeds, and whole grains support overall immune health.


6. Is sleep important?


Yes. Adequate sleep is essential for healthy immune function.


7. Can diabetes reduce immunity?


Poorly controlled diabetes can increase the risk of infections.


8. Can vitamin deficiency affect immunity?


Deficiencies in nutrients such as vitamin D, vitamin C, zinc, iron, and vitamin B12 may affect immune health.


9. Can exercise improve immunity?


Moderate, regular exercise supports overall health and immune function.


10. When should I seek medical advice?


If you have frequent, severe, or recurrent infections, consult a qualified healthcare professional.
